Google's Upcoming Optional Auto-Reboot Feature for Enhanced Android Security
2025-04-16

An innovative security feature is set to debut in the Android ecosystem, offering users an optional auto-reboot function. This new capability aims to enhance device security by resetting devices that remain inactive for a prolonged period. According to recent updates on Google’s official release notes, the functionality will be voluntary, giving users control over its activation. The mechanism aligns with modern encryption standards, ensuring sensitive data remains protected when devices are left unused.

This advancement stems from Google's ongoing efforts to fortify Android's security protocols. The system leverages file-based encryption (FBE), which segments data encryption rather than applying a single key to the entire device. When a user locks their phone, certain portions of the data remain encrypted until the first unlock occurs. If a device stays locked for three continuous days, it triggers an automatic reboot, transitioning the device back to a secure pre-unlock state. This process mitigates risks associated with unauthorized access or forensic investigations on seized devices. While primarily beneficial for individuals requiring heightened privacy measures, such as those enrolled in Google’s Advanced Protection Program, the feature caters to broader security needs.

Technological progress often brings concerns about usability and convenience. By making the auto-reboot optional, Google addresses potential disruptions to secondary devices used for background tasks or notifications. Users prioritizing constant connectivity can disable this feature without compromising overall device performance.
